Cantor Fitzgerald Investment Advisors L.P. grew its stake in shares of Target Co. (NYSE:TGT – Free Report) by 30.8%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The firm owned 110,698 shares of the retailer’s stock after acquiring an additional 26,071 shares during the quarter. Cantor Fitzgerald Investment Advisors L.P.’s holdings in Target were worth $14,964,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Target Announces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Saturday, March 1st.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, February 12th will be paid a dividend of $1.12 per share. This represents a $4.48 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.41%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, February 12th. Target’s payout ratio is 47.51%.

About Target
Target Corporation operates as a general merchandise retailer in the United States. The company offers apparel for women, men, boys, girls, toddlers, and infants and newborns, as well as jewelry, accessories, and shoes; and beauty and personal care, baby gear, cleaning, paper products, and pet supplies.
